  • ACE: Can I loadbalance based on client Source IP/and client tcp source port?

    We recently migrated serving a client from being thick client at the desktop to being served via a citrix farm.  Prior to the migration the clients came from about 5000 unique source IP's to their VIP, now they come from only 31 unique source IP's from the citrix servers in the farm. A citrix server can host 400 client sessions, since the default action of the ACE is to loadbalance based on source IP's, the ACE is sending up to 400 sessions from one citrix server to 1 real server in the farm.  Is there anyway I can loadbalance based on client source IP and tcp source port so the ACE views the 400 sessions from one citrix server as unique sessions?  The application does not require persistence.

    Hello,
    Yes, you can configure a "Sticky Layer 4 Payload" as descirbed on this Link:
    http://www.cisco.com/en/US/docs/interfaces_modules/services_modules/ace/vA2_3_0/command/reference/sticky.html#wp1039276
    Unfrotunately I do not have any working example. You must calculate the right values for the Offset and the Length to configure.

  • Best practices for securing communication to internet based SCCM clients ?

    What type of SSL certs does the community think should be used to secure traffic from internet based SCCM clients ?  should 3rd party SSL certs be used ?  When doing an inventory for example of the clients configuration in order to run reports
    later how the  data be protected during transit ?

    From a technical perspective, it doesn't matter where the certs come from as there is no difference whatsoever. A cert is a cert is a cert. The certs are *not* what provide the protection, they simply enable the use of SSL to protect the data in transit
    and also provide an authentication mechanism.
    From a logistics and cost perspective though, there is a huge difference. You may not be aware, but *every* client in IBCM requires its own unique client authentication certificate. This will get very expensive very quickly and is a recurring cost because
    certs expire (most commercial cert vendors rarely offer certs valid for more than 3 years). Also, deploying certs from a 3rd party is not a trivial endeavor -- you more less run into chicken and egg issues here. With an internal Microsoft PKI, if designed
    properly, there is zero recurring cost and deployment to internal systems is trivial. There is still certainly some cost and overhead involved, but it is dwarfed by that that comes with using with a third party CA for IBCM certs.

  • T-code based iviews in HTML format

    Hi,
    Please do let me know how to dispaly the t-code based iviews in HTML format through portal.Actually we need to dispaly some ABAP reports through portal in SRM.Should the reports be first converted to HTML format.
    Also,we need to create the PO field as hyperlink which should take the supplier to a particulatr PO as and when he clicks on it.Can this(hyperlink)  be done in portal.
    Thanks in Advance,
    Manu

    Hi Manu,
    In order to display the iviews in HTML format you need to enable the ITS services from your SAP System first of all.
    You can do so by following these steps:
    Step 1.
    1.Configure the Rz10 profile parameters for the host name and the port no.
    2.Check that parameters appearing in the SE80 settings and ITS Server settings.
    After activating ITS Services these steps more needs to be done to make them usable.
    1. Go to SE80-Edit ITS Service SYSTEM-> Publish it completely.
    2. Go to SE80-Edit ITS Service SHUFFLER-> Publish it completely.
    3. Go to SE80-Edit ITS Service WEBGUI-> Publish it completely.
    4. Go to SE38-Run the Program W3_PUBLISH_SERVICES and publish all the webservices.
    From transaction SICF now you need to enable the services.
    1.Go to sap/bc/gui activate the complete node.
    2.Go to sap/bc/icf activate the complete node.
    3.Go to sap/bc/ping activate the complete node.
    4.Go to sap/public/bc activate the complete node.
    Now give the ITS parameters in the system you created and create a SAP Transaction Iview. inside its property editor choose the option SAPGUI for HTML.
